Butterfly wefts are engineered with a flexible, lightweight structure that allows the hair to expand and contract naturally. Unlike traditional machine wefts, they feature softly layered strands that mimic natural density at the root while maintaining movement through the ends.

For K tips, I tips and Nano- 25 grams per pack. 1 gram per strand
For Genius , Butterfly and Machine Wefts- 16"-22" is 50 gram weft
24" and longer- 60 gram weft
Tape and Invisible tape- 50 grams per pack. 20 pcs which is 10 sandwiches
Wide tape wefts- 50 grams per wide weft
Hand Tied Wefts- 16”- 22” 134 grams per bundle. 24” and longer - 160 grams per bundle
For lengths 16-18" extensions you'll need 50 -75 Grams of hair if your only looking for fuller hair or adding highlights or lowlights. If you're looking to add length, 100-150 Grams should be good for a full head depending on how thick your hair is. If you have thin, fine hair, 100 grams should suffice.
20"-22". Again 50-75 Grams should be good to thicken hair or add that pop of color for hair that is already this length. 120-180 Grams is usually good for this length for a full head, depending on the length and thickness of your own hair.
24-26". If you're buying hair this long, chances are you are buying for length. Usually 160 - 240 Grams of hair is good for this length. for a full head.
Hair 28" and longer should be 200-300 Grams of Hair. Anything less will be hard to blend and you want to make sure you have thickness through the ends of your hair. No one likes thin, straggly ends.
